TIQ-A
CAS No. 420849-22-5
TIQ-A( —— )
Catalog No. M28456 CAS No. 420849-22-5
TIQ-A is a PARP1 inhibitor which involved in DNA single-strand break repair via the base excision repair pathway. PARP1 is triggered by DNA damage and its excessive activation has been proposed as a causative factor in many pathological conditions including ischemia and reperfusion injury, asthma-related inflammation, and atherogenesis.
